12012000112067 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 12012000112068. Its totient is φ = 12012000112066.

The previous prime is 12012000112001. The next prime is 12012000112087. The reversal of 12012000112067 is 76021100021021.

It is a strong pr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 12012000112067 - 228 = 12011731676611 is a prime.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(12012000112087)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 6006000056033 + 6006000056034.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(6006000056034).

Almost surely, 212012000112067 is an apocalyptic number.

12012000112067 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

12012000112067 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

12012000112067 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 336, while the sum is 23.

Adding to 12012000112067 its reverse (76021100021021), we get a palindrome (88033100133088).

The spelling of 12012000112067 in words is "twelve trillion, twelve billion, one hundred twelve thousand, sixty-seven".
